The strong electroacoustic coupling in metal semiconductor oxides can significantly change their electronic structure and physical properties. In this paper, the effect of lattice vibration on the electronic structure of iron oxide is studied. Theoretical studies have shown that lattice vibration enhances the disorder of the structure, which leads to the localization of the electronic structure at the edge of the band gap and promotes the formation of hole polarons, thus limiting the carrier transport performance and photocatalytic water decomposition efficiency in iron oxide.
